two.1.4) Short description
NHS Midlands and Lancashire Commissioning
Support Unit (MLCSU) is working on behalf of North Staffordshire Combined Healthcare NHS Trust (NSCHT) who are looking to undertake a Competitive Process for a Crisis Alternative Provision for Stoke on Trent & North Staffordshire .
The service is intended to provide a Crisis House / Sanctuary / Safe Haven-type service for those in Mental Health crisis, as an alternative to hospital admission.
NSCHT would like to invite all potential providers to
an Engagement Event Monday 2nd December 2024
1:00pm-2:00pm via Microsoft Teams.
The purpose of the Engagement Event is to share
the background and the need for this service locally and share the intended outcomes of the service. Commissioners would like to understand the current market and their perspectives.

The estimated contract value is £1,100,000 for a 5 year contract (3 years with an option to extend once, and then once again). This value is subject to change.
